What does LA grade B reflux esophagitis mean?

LA grade B: one or several erosions limited to the mucosal fold(s) and larger than 5 mm in extent (as secondary findings on the left lower image, cicatricial changes in the mucosa may be noted as signs of chronic recurrent reflux esophagitis).

How do you fix reflux esophagitis?

Esophagitis Treatments

  1. Over-the-counter drugs like antacids, or medications that block acid production like lansoprazole (Prevacid) and omeprazole (Prilosec).
  2. Prescription drugs that can block acid production or help clear your stomach.
  3. Surgery to strengthen the valve that separates your stomach and your esophagus.

What does reflux esophagitis mean?

Reflux esophagitis is an esophageal mucosal injury that occurs secondary to retrograde flux of gastric contents into the esophagus. Clinically, this is referred to as g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D).

How bad is grade C reflux esophagitis?

Of the 40–60% of reflux disease patients who have definite endoscopic oesophagitis, this is severe in 10–20% (grades C and D, Los Angeles Classification system). proton pump inhibitors have revolutionized the medical therapy of reflux disease because of their high success rate in this indication.

Can esophagitis be cured?

Esophagitis can usually heal without intervention, but to aid in the recovery, eaters can adopt what’s known as an esophageal, or soft food, diet. The goal of this kind of diet is to make eating less painful and to keep food from lingering in the esophagus and causing irritation.

What is La grade B reflux esophagitis?

Lia Louis answered LA grade B reflux esophagitis is a disease that leads to the inflammation of the oesophagus and it can be either chronic or acute. LA simply stands for Los Angeles and is a classification system used to diagnose the extent of esophagitis. It is graded on a scale of A to D and differs in size.

What are the possible side effects of esophagitis disease?

Possible complications include: 1 Scarring or narrowing (stricture) of the esophagus 2 Tearing of the esophagus lining tissue from retching (if food gets stuck) or during endoscopy (due to inflammation) 3 Barrett’s esophagus, characterized by changes to the cells lining the esophagus, increasing your risk of esophageal cancer
